Formal Name : Oriolus xanthornus
Other Name(s) : Black-headed Oriole
Length : 36 cm. Wingspan: About 15 cm
Photo spot : Hu-wei Battery Park
The Black-headed Oriole has a bright yellow body, pink beak, bright red iris, with a thick and long black line across the eye all the way to the back of the head, forming a circle; the wing feathers are black at the inside; outside feathers are bright yellow at the edge, the tail feathers are black, and the feet are lead blue.
Black-headed Orioles are a rare and protected bird species. They are winter migratory birds that are not commonly seen and rarely stay in Taiwan. Individual birds have been recorded to have spent the winter in Tamsun, Yehliu, Chinshan in the North and Kenting in the South. There are only a few spots where they have been recorded to appear throughout the year and reproduced. Currently there have been movement records in the area from Tamsun Golf Course to Shalun. They are the most beautiful birds in the Tamsun area.
